Indianapolis officials and developer Rebar Development have provided scant updates on reviving the long-vacant Old City Hall, a century-old landmark in the Mile Square area. The article details how the ambitious redevelopment project, first announced in 2022, has ground to a halt amid funding uncertainties and leadership changes. It matters because the building's deterioration threatens its historical value, and failure could mean demolition or further neglect in a city pushing urban renewal.
